University of Stirling

The University of Stirling continues to have several unique factors outside of its location. It is a pioneer of a two-semester structure and modular degrees, allowing great flexibility in start times and changes in study. Degrees are also made up of credits earned from modules, which means that students can effectively change their subject as/or if their interests change. More than 95% of all undergraduates were in employment or further study fifteen months after graduation (Graduate Outcomes Survey 2020, HESA) and it was Stirling students who named the University first in Scotland for having good teachers, quality lecturers and performance feedback (International Student Barometer 2016).Work placement opportunities are also encouraged. These include 'Making the most of your Masters' and a university initiative with Edinburgh and Aberdeen aimed at building links between universities and employers. A number of scholarships are also available for international and EU students and details can be found here, while Student Money Advisers can help you with your budget and assist in applying for financial support.

The University of Stirling is a modern public university located in Scotland, known for its picturesque campus and strong academic reputation. It offers a wide range of undergraduate and postgraduate programs, with a focus on research and student experience. The university excels in sports science, health, environmental studies, and social sciences. It boasts excellent facilities, a diverse international student body, and strong graduate employment rates. Stirling is also recognized for its supportive learning environment and commitment to sustainability.
